Step2: Recall the congruence postulates
- AAS (Angle - Angle - Side): Requires two angles and a non - included side.
- CPCTC (Corresponding Parts of Congruent Triangles are Congruent): Is used after proving triangles congruent, not to prove them congruent.
- SAS (Side - Angle - Side): Requires two sides and the included angle. Here, we have two sides (marked equal) and the included angle (common angle) between them.
- ASA (Angle - Side - Angle): Requires two angles and the included side.
